Map of City of Vancouver showing distribution of electric light, gas, & power services
Part of Major Matthews collection
Item is a map which shows the City of Vancouver in the early parts of the 20th century (ca. 1905) and depicts city blocks which had been supplied with electric street lights, with electric power and gas service. J.S. Matthews annotated the map in 1947 with counts of electric street lights in various neighbourhoods.
